More than 3,000 people across the country were surveyed, and Illinois chose gum. GUM. LIKE, WHAT? I'M SORRY?

Wrigley's gum has been around forever, but it's kind of weird it was chosen to define us. It was founded way back in 1891, in Chicago, too! That's really cool history, so in a way it does make sense that we'd rally behind a true Illinois product started right here in the Windy City.
Wrigley isn't just gum, though. We all know that. It's an iconic name of Chicago sports, too. The company actually bought the name rights to the Cubs' ballpark in 1927, and Wrigley Field has been a landmark and tourist attraction ever since. It draws hundreds of thousands of people every year.
